Review of Phonics-Based Programs
Recognizing phonics-based programs is essential for effectively supporting dyslexic students. These programs focus on the relationship between sounds and letters, aiding trainees decipher words via systematic guideline. They stress the value of phonemic awareness, which is the ability to listen to and control noises in spoken words. By understanding this skill, you'll pave the way for improved analysis and punctuation capabilities.
Phonics-based programs generally include structured lessons that introduce new audios and letter mixes incrementally. This method enables students to improve their knowledge gradually, strengthening what they have actually learned through technique.
Several programs also integrate multisensory strategies, engaging aesthetic, auditory, and tactile pathways to improve discovering retention.
As you check out various phonics-based programs, you'll observe that some are a lot more versatile than others, permitting individualized guideline tailored to individual requirements. Others might be much more stiff, adhering to a set sequence.
Whichever you choose, it's essential to make sure that the program is evidence-based and has a tested track record of success with dyslexic learners. In this manner, you can with confidence support their journey towards becoming competent readers.
Strengths and Weaknesses
Phonics-based programs offer substantial strengths for dyslexic learners, especially in their systematic technique to mentor reading. These programs break down the intricacies of language into workable parts, aiding you build necessary decoding abilities. You'll appreciate exactly how these approaches focus on the connection between letters and audios, making it simpler to recognize the mechanics of reading. This structured structure can boost your self-confidence and provide a clear pathway to improved literacy.
However, there are weaknesses to think about. Some phonics-based programs might be excessively stiff, not accommodating different discovering styles. If you prosper in a much more all natural setting, you may find such programs limiting.
Additionally, while phonics is important, it's not the only facet of reading. These programs sometimes overlook understanding methods and vocabulary advancement, which are equally vital for coming to be a proficient reader.
Finally, the pacing of phonics direction can be a double-edged sword. If you have a hard time, you might find it testing to keep up, resulting in frustration.
Balancing the toughness and weaknesses of phonics-based programs is necessary for producing an effective learning experience customized to your needs.
